#USCorePCEMay PCE Inflation Data - May 2025 (U.S.)
📌 Core PCE (excluding food and energy):
Monthly: +0.2%
Year-on-Year: +2.7% (up from 2.6% in April)
📌 Overall PCE (including food and energy):
Monthly: +0.1%
Year-on-Year: +2.3% (up from 2.2% in April)
🔍 Why is this important?
It is the Fed's preferred measure of inflation.
The increase to 2.7% annually suggests that inflation remains above the 2% target.
This could delay potential interest rate cuts by the Fed.
